Output 70e950995ef55da8dcee3febcb56969af7cd15cd220cc97664e9d54a5816a947:1

value
3803978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b83f2870db941cbee4aabdbcc8231795c792e1e OP_EQUAL
address
3QcubZHNKTiaLCWmehFTaVNWD8GpnR9i3P
transaction
70e950995ef55da8dcee3febcb56969af7cd15cd220cc97664e9d54a5816a947
spent
true